Washington Capitals forward Marcus Johansson has been ruled out of Saturday's matinee against the visiting New York Rangers due to a non-COVID illness. Saturday's game will be the first that Johansson has missed this season. Johansson's 13 goals this season rank only behind star captain Alex Ovechkin (32) for the team lead. The Sacramento Kings are waiving forward KZ Okpala on Saturday, ESPN reported. He has not played since Jan. 28 and is scheduled to have season-ending knee surgery, per the report. Okpala, 23, averaged 1.3 points and 7.1 minutes in 35 games (three starts) in his first season with the Kings. The Green Bay Packers reportedly cleared more than $16 million salary cap space by reworking two contracts. They restructured deals for cornerback Jaire Alexander and defensive end Preston Smith, NFL Network said Saturday. The Packers freed up $9.456 million with Alexander's contract and another $6.668 million with Smith's, per the report. Crisis is a symptom of a sport torn between the commercial imperative to play more and the medical imperative to play less You might have missed it in all the excitement, but Sergio Parisse finally announced his retirement late last month. After 21 years, 470 professional games, 142 Test matches (94 of them as captain), 15 Six Nations championships and five World Cups, Parisse had decided to quit at the end of the season.
